Transaction 809966631ac23b5c39c83ec3523b5a318b65fd6a83f70d46068685a988a91fe5
1 Input
1 Output
-
809966631ac23b5c39c83ec3523b5a318b65fd6a83f70d46068685a988a91fe5:0
- value
- 1250
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4730124f0ed11638620e31cef821e2b24fa881bb62a3a6227c2473d65523ecb0
- address
- bc1pgucpyncw6ytrscswx880sg0zkf863qdmv236vgnuy3eav4frajcq2dp7z9